We have seen it happen in Tamil movies. A would-be bride/groom elopes on wedding day, leaving their prospective spouse waiting at the dias, and to save face, the runaway person's family decides to get another member person of their family married off to the jilted person.
A similar incident occurred in Odisha, India, recently, but there's a not-so happy ending to this saga - police had to come in to rescue the minor girl who was forced to become a sudden bride at the dias, as child marriage is prohibited in India.
According to reports, the incident unfolded last Tuesday evening at the Kalahandi district, when the would-be-bride eloped with her boyfriend just minutes before the wedding ceremony, leaving the groom waiting.
Humiliated by the incident, the bride's family offered the woman's 15-year younger sister for marriage with the 26-year-old groom.
Hearing the news, district administration officials reached the groom's house and took away the girl, who's preparing to sit for her Class 10 examination.
According to reports, neither the bride's nor the groom's families were aware of the fact that child marriage is illegal.
The girl's father told the authorities that he agreed to arrange for her marriage due to peer pressure.
The authorities did not register case against both the families, and arranged for counselling sessions for them. They also told the girl to appear for her examination, and told her family not to solemnise her marriage before she attains the marriageable age of 18 years.
